A newly synthesized new material of cubic boron -nitride, with high hardness and good abrasion resistance, and has a wide range of applications in the mechanical processing industry. Cube boron nitride is extremely high, second only to diamond, so it is extremely strict for its crushing grading equipment. At present, the MQW airflow crusher is usually used to process cubic boron nitride. This crushing method can be obtained by obtaining cubic boron nitride fine powder and ensure that the equipment is not worn by raw materials, and it is displayed by many actual cases. The MQW airflow crusher is an effective way to process cubic boron nitride.
MQW airflow crusher is a whole set of components composed of feeders, crushing hosts, whirlwind collectors, dust collectors, references, control cabinets and other components The production line, its operating principle is: compressing the air for drying, and after drying, enter the crushing cavity through the nozzle. In the crushing cavity, the material can be crushed through high pressure airflow. After the centrifugal force generated by the hierarchical turbine, the thick and thin materials can be separated. The particles that meet the granularity requirements are to enter the whirlwind separator and the dust collector, collect it, and the particles that do not meet the requirements continue to be crushed. Due to the high hardness of the cubic boron nitride, it is easy to cause severe wear to the crushing equipment when crushing, so the MQW airflow crusher uses the inner lining method and pastes the abrasion -resistant lining with ceramics or polyuretin in the raw materials. , Effectively reduce wear and greatly extend the service life of the equipment. At present, a cubic boron nitride can be used to use the MQW air flow crushing mechanism to easily obtain a fine powder of 3-20 microns, and the particle size is uniform and highly decentralized.
